  Brushy Mountain State Penitentiary -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Brushy Mountain State Penitentiary now renamed Brushy Mountain Correctional Complex (also called Brushy) is a large prison near the town of Petros, Tennessee, operated by the Tennessee Department of Correction.
Among the most famous inmates at Brushy Mountain was James Earl Ray, the convicted assassin of Martin Luther King, Jr.
The prison was founded as a result of the aftermath of the "Coal Creek War," an 1891 lockout of coal miners that took place in Coal Creek and Briceville, Tennessee, after miners protested the use of unpaid convict labor in the mines.

 theheraldnewspapers.com   (Site not responding. Last check: 2007-11-04)
The expansion project will cost $180.5 million, with approximately $61 million expected to be contributed by the federal government.  The construction phase is expected to last three years bringing the new facility online in spring 2009.
The expanded Morgan County facility is designed to house 2,441 inmates, and when it opens the old Brushy Mountain prison will be closed.  Both sites currently house 1,603 prisoners therefore the net increase of new space will be 838 beds.
Brushy Mountain Correctional Complex will employ nearly 700 people and have an annual operating budget of approximately $45 million.  The facility is located at 500 Flat Fork Road in Wartburg, Tenn.
